<<
>>

39. ІНЖЕНЕР-ПРОГРАМІСТ

Завдання та обов'язки. На основі аналізу математичних моделей і алгоритмів рішення економічних та інших задач розроблює програми, які забезпечують можливість виконання алгоритму і, відповідно, поставлену задачу засобами обчислювальної техніки, проводить їх тестування і налагодження.
Розроблює технологію розв'язання задачі на всіх етапах. Здійснює вибір мови програмування і переклад нею алгоритмів задач. Визначає інформацію, яка підлягає обробленню засобами обчислювальної техніки, її обсяги, структуру, макети і схеми вводу, оброблення, зберігання і видавання інформації, методи її контролю. Визначає обсяги і зміст даних тестових прикладів, які забезпечують найбільш повну перевірку відповідності програм їх функціональному призначенню. Виконує роботи під час підготовки програм до налагодження і проводить їх налагодження. Розроблює інструкції на роботи з програмами, оформлює необхідну технічну документацію Визначає можливість використання готових програмних засобів. Здійснює супроводження впроваджених програм і програмних засобів. Розроблює і впроваджує методи і засоби автоматизації програмування, типові і стандартні програмні засоби. Бере участь у проектних роботах. На основі логічного аналізу проводить камеральну перевірку програм. Визначає сукупність даних, що забезпечують урахування максимального числа умов, які включено до програми, виконує роботи з її підготовки до налагодження. Здійснює запуск налагоджених програм і введення вихідних даних, які визначаються умовами поставлених задач. Проводить коректування розробленої програми на основі аналізу вихідних даних. Розроблює інструкції щодо роботи з програмами, оформляє необхідну технічну документацію. Визначає можливість використання готових програм, розроблених іншими підприємствами (установами). Розроблює і впроваджує методи автоматизації програмування, типові і стандартні програми, програмуючі програми, транслятори, вхідні алгоритмічні мови.
Розробляє і впроваджує системи автоматичної перевірки правильності програм, типові і стандартні програмні засоби, складає технологію оброблення інформації. Виконує роботи з уніфікації і типізації обчислювальних процесів. Бере участь у створенні каталогів і картотек стандартних програм, розробленні форм документів, які підлягають машинному обробленню, у проектних роботах, що стосуються розширення сфери застосування обчислювальної техніки.

Повинен знати: керівні і нормативні матеріали, які регламентують методи розробки алгоритмів і програм та використання обчислювальної техніки в процесі оброблення інформації; основні принципи структурного програмування, техніко-експлуатаційні характеристики, конструктивні особливості, призначення і режими роботи устаткування, правила його технічної експлуатації; технологію механізованого оброблення інформації; види технічних носіїв інформації; методи класифікації і кодування інформації; формалізовані мови програмування; чинні стандарти, системи числення, шифрів і кодів; методи програмування; порядок оформлення технічної документації; передовий вітчизняний і світовий досвід програмування і використання обчислювальної техніки; основи економіки, організації праці і виробництва.

Кваліфікаційні вимоги.

Провідний інженер-програміст: повна вища освіта відповідного напряму підготовки (магістр, спеціаліст). Стаж роботи за професією інженера-програміста I категорії - не менше 2 років.

Інженер-програміст I категорії: повна вища освіта відповідного напряму підготовки (магістр, спеціаліст). Стаж роботи за професією інженера-програміста II категорії: для магістра - не менше 2 років, спеціаліста - не менше 3 років.

Інженер-програміст II категорії: повна вища освіта відповідного напряму підготовки (магістр, спеціаліст), для магістра - без вимог до стажу роботи, для спеціаліста - стаж роботи за професією інженера-програміста III категорії - не менше 2 років.

Інженер-програміст III категорії: повна вища освіта відповідного напряму підготовки (спеціаліст). Стаж роботи за професією інженера-програміста - не менше 1 року.

Інженер-програміст: повна вища освіта відповідного напряму підготовки (спеціаліст) без вимог до стажу роботи.

<< | >>
Источник: Довідник. Довідник кваліфікаційних характеристик професій працівників. Випуск 1. Професії працівників, що є загальними для всіх видів економічної діяльності. 2004

Еще по теме 39. ІНЖЕНЕР-ПРОГРАМІСТ:

  1. 31. ТЕХНІК-ПРОГРАМІСТ
  2. 38. ІНЖЕНЕР-ЛАБОРАНТ
  3. 15. ІНЖЕНЕР
  4. 36. ІНЖЕНЕР-ЕЛЕКТРОНІК
  5. 30. ІНЖЕНЕР З ПІДГОТОВКИ ВИРОБНИЦТВА
  6. 18. ІНЖЕНЕР З КОМПЛЕКТАЦІЇ УСТАТКУВАННЯ
  7. 17. ІНЖЕНЕР З ІНСТРУМЕНТУ
  8. 37. ІНЖЕНЕР-КОНСТРУКТОР
  9. 35. ІНЖЕНЕР-ДОСЛІДНИК
  10. 33. ІНЖЕНЕР З ЯКОСТІ
  11. 34. ІНЖЕНЕР ІЗ СТАНДАРТИЗАЦІЇ
  12. 40. ІНЖЕНЕР-ТЕХНОЛОГ
  13. 32. ІНЖЕНЕР З РЕМОНТУ